(Image: Ed Komenda/Reno Gazette Journal)The Economic Policy Institute (EPI) says in its job-loss projections report that Nevada stands to lose 5.3 percent of its private-sector workforce, or 66,656 jobs. As a result, states where these industries make up a larger share of employment, such as Florida, Hawaii, and Nevada, will be particularly hard hit,” the EPI said.In Nevada, where two out of every five jobs are in leisure, hospitality, or retail, the state will likely lose 5.3 private of private-sector jobs,” the report concluded.As of January, 355,300 Nevadans were employed in the leisure and hospitality sector.
